winemaker's notes:

Like the dark red ruby the color of this wine resembles, Nita is a rare gem from the Spanish appellation of Priorat. From a region typically known for its concentrated barrel-aged reds, this wine is one of only a few jovens, or non-barrel aged wines, made within this celebrated appellation. Uneffectedby the toasted notes and wood tannins that barrel aging can produce, the 2009 Nita is perfect for those who want to taste the fruit and terroir of a wine in its purest form. Brain child of young female winemaker Meritxell Pallejà, this wine retains all of the characteristic mineralityof Priorat, while better preserving the complex fruit flavors of the old-vine Garnachaand Cariñena. Containing a primary bouquet of ripe red berries, violets and flint, this wine also has beautiful notes of tobacco, chocolate and fresh cream. As the wine also has lower alcohol thanmost Priorat wines, the 2009 Nita is fresh and easy to drink, with good acidity and juicy tannins that support a long finish.

alcohol by volume: 14.5%
critical acclaim:

"The 2009 Nita is a rare, value-priced Priorat that over-delivers in a big way. This unoaked cuvee, made by Meritxell Palleja from purchased fruit, is a blend of 45% Garnacha, 35% Carinena, with the balance Cabernet Sauvignon and Syrah. It displays a fragrant bouquet of liquid minerality, lavender, incense, black cherry, and black raspberry. This leads to a concentrated, forward, savory offering with layers of ripe fruit, succulent flavors, good acidity, and excellent freshness. Although it has the stuffing to evolve for several years, it can be approached now. It is a great introduction to the DO of Priorat."

92 Points

The Wine Advocate

"Glass-staining ruby. Raspberry, cherry-cola and spices on the highly fragrant nose. Sweet and supple in texture, with lush red and dark berry flavors, notes of white pepper and violet and no rough edges. Expands on the finish, which features juicy cherry and blackberry qualities. I find this awfully delicious right now but it has the depth to age."

91 Points

International Wine Cellar
